Distance

When deciding on a four-wheeled electric scooter, it is important to consider the distance it will cover on a single charge. The distance a scooter is capable of covering is contingent on its weight and the size of the battery. In general, lightweight mobility scooters have smaller batteries, allowing them to travel shorter distances.

Some scooters come with batteries that are removable and can be replaced when they are exhausted. This allows you to increase the distance that they can travel. However, the amount of distance the scooter can cover will also depend on the conditions of the terrain and weather. For more details, you can consult your user guide or speak to an expert.

Battery life

The battery life of an electric scooter is crucial to the overall performance and effectiveness of the scooter. Avoid accelerations that are rapid and frequent stopping to extend your range. Instead, use gradual speeding and anticipate the need for braking to decrease energy consumption. It is also recommended to ride on flat surfaces rather than steep slopes. Many electric 4 wheel mobility scooter scooters have brakes that are specially designed to allows the motor to recover energy and prolong battery life.

Another aspect that can affect your battery's lifespan is how often you charge it. If you use your battery frequently it will degrade faster than if it's charged regularly. You should always adhere to the manufacturer's guidelines when charging your scooter. If you don't, the battery could become overheated or swell and create a safety risk.

A lithium-ion battery usually has between 300 and 400 charge cycles. It's recommended that you never allow the battery to run out completely. You must not just stop the battery from becoming depleted however, you should also clean it in order to prolong its life. It's also a good idea to remove any unnecessary clutter from your scooter, as it can increase the weight and use more energy. Finally, keeping the tires properly inflated will help minimize energy consumption.

Some scooters come with an option to connect an additional battery that can double the range or power of the original. Connecting two batteries can cause damage to the wiring and is not always secure. It's best to consult with an expert to learn more about the best way to upgrade your scooter.
